Road Repairs Causing Problems for Abilene Drivers

Some Abilene residents are complaining about loose gravel after some recent road repairs.

After the city sealed about 20 miles of roads in north and south Abilene, some drivers are experiencing loose gravel.

Though it seems like a hazard, the city said that this is normal and it will take about two months for the roads to even out, but drivers should always pay attention.

"Drivers should always drive cautiously," says city engineer Chad Carter. "And if there's a location where, that they perceive as a concern, they need to let us know."

The city plans to pick up the loose gravel in the next two months.
